When Vladek is telling the story of Artie's birth, he notes that the doctors had to break Artic's arm in order to "save" his son's life. Vladek then reports that when Artie was a baby, his arm sometimes "jumped up." Vladek reports that he and Anja "joked and called you 'Heil Hitler" (32). This scene raises the question of the role that jokes and humor can play within a text about the Holocaust. Indeed, when they are staying at the sanitarium, Vladek tells jokes to Anja in hopes of improving her health (37). What role does humor play in Art Spiegelman's Maus? Do jokes about the Holocaust have the effect of trivializing a historical tragedy? Or do jokes help the survivors to endure their traumatic experiences? Do jokes help the survivors to reclaim their humanity?
